iOS_Tag标签_程序员俱乐部

中国优秀的程序员网站程序员频道CXYCLUB技术地图
热搜:
更多>>
 
当前位置:程序员俱乐部 >>Tag标签 >> iOS >>列表
· iOS开发-UI (一)常用控件发布时间:2017-01-17
从这里开始是UI篇知识点:1.常用IOS基本控件2.UITouch=======================常用基本控件1.UISegmentedControl:分段控制器1)创建方式-(id)initWithItems:(NSArray*)items;items数组中可以有NSString或者是UIImage对象UISegmentedControl*seg=[[UISegmentedControlalloc]initWithItems:@[@"广州",@"深圳",@"珠海"]];2... 查看全文
· iOS开发-UI (二)Button和Image发布时间:2017-01-17
知识点:1.UIButton使用和事件机制2.UIImage3.自定义UIButton==================UIButton1... 查看全文
· iOS图片拉伸发布时间:2017-01-17
假如下面的一张图片,是用来做按钮的背景图片的,原始尺寸是76×40我们通过代码将这张图片设置为按钮的背景图片,假如我们将创建好的按钮的宽高设置为:(W=200,H=50)代码如下://初始化按钮UIButton*button=[[UIButtonalloc]init];//设置尺寸button.frame=CGRectMake(100,200,200,50);//加载图片UIImage*image=[UIImageimageNamed:@"ppm_new_shuliang.png"]... 查看全文
继承、多态、类别学习目标1、继承的含义2、父类子类的别称3、字段和消息的继承4、重写和重写消息的调用5、多态6、类别(Category)=============================================1.需要理解的知识面向对象的三个基本特征:1、封装2、继承3、多态1、继承(单继承):父类(超类)和子类的关系。继承的两个类,存在父子关系。OC支持单继承,不支持多继承。1.1生活中的继承人(父类)——男人/女人(子类)男人/女人(父类)———学生(子类)学生(父类... 查看全文
· iOS开发-文件操作发布时间:2017-01-15
目录操作和文件管理学习目标1.理解单例2.掌握NSFileManager类常用的文件管理操3.掌握NSFileHandle类常用的文件数据操作4.了解NSData类的常用操作5.掌握Plist文件读写——————————————————————通常程序在运行中或者程序结束之后,需要保存一些信息,而且需要持久化存储信息,比如登陆信息、视频播放记录、收藏记录等等,那么我们可以采用以下几种方式对数据进行持久化保存.1.1单例模式(当前对象有且仅有一个实例)好处:只有一个实例,数据共享... 查看全文
BI中文站1月9日报道本周早些时候有传闻称,下一版iPhone操作系统,即iOS10.3,将支持所谓的“剧院模式”。业内人士猜测,在这一模式中,当用户在电影院时,一系列设置将确保手机对他人的干扰最小化。毫无疑问,铁杆影迷对这一消息的反应大多负面。AlamoDrafthouse院线此前就发起活动,对在电影院中发消息的行为表示反对。该公司发布Twitter消息称,iPhone“已拥有了剧院模式”,但在一张截图上配以“关机”按钮... 查看全文
目前,微软、苹果、谷歌三家的操作系统和设备均覆盖手机到桌面终端,有网友调侃说,最棒的组合是Win电脑+iPad+安卓手机。这样结论见仁见智,现在,著名统计机构Gartner分析了未来两年智能设备的出货,具体来说是PC+手机平板。报告认为,随着WindowsPhone的死亡,今年,iOS+OSX的出货就将超过Windows设备,达到2.68亿部,而Win的出货是2.52亿,这一比较优势将延续到2019年。背后的逻辑就是此消彼长,WinPC的衰落、iPhone/Mac的强势等。当然... 查看全文
1月8日,三星近日宣布,为旗下Gear系列产品推出了期待已久的iOS版应用,其中就包括GearS2与S3智能手表以及GearFit2健康追踪器等在内。这两类新应用可以让用户把自己的三星设备与iPhone连接起来,协同使用。在此之前,Gear设备只能与Android设备兼容使用。三星方面宣称,GearS应用可以让用户在三星智能手表上下载和安装相关应用,并将通知信息从iPhone手机上推送到三星智能手表上,同时还可以让苹果手机与三星SHealth应用同步各种身体与健康相关的数据。除此之外... 查看全文
· ios开发之C语言第一天发布时间:2017-01-09
最近在学习ios开发,先学习C语言,再学习OC和swift.正所谓"万丈高楼平地起",打好基础是很重要的,所以C语言也必须好好学习.学习中所使用的操作系统是OSX,开发工具是Xcode.操作系统操作系统是什么?是一个软件,直接运行在硬件之上.操作系统有什么用?主要是用来管理计算机的硬件设备硬件,接口,操作系统三者关系的比喻如果把计算机硬件比喻成一台汽车,那么方向盘,离合器,变速杆什么的就像是操作系统,驾驶人并不知道汽车如何工作,但是通过汽车提供给我们的接口(方向盘,油门,刹车等... 查看全文
· iOS开源项目周报1229发布时间:2017-01-09
由OpenDigg出品的iOS开源项目周报第三期来啦。我们的iOS开源周报集合了OpenDigg一周来新收录的优质的iOS开发方面的开源项目,方便iOS开发人员便捷的找到自己需要的项目工具等... 查看全文
今天是圣诞前夕,圣诞老人又名克里斯·克林格将从北极开始它的全球之旅。这个快乐的老人将登上他的魔术雪橇,并为给世界各地的好男孩和好女孩带去礼物。用户现在可以使用Google的“圣诞老人追踪器”再次跟踪圣诞老人的旅程。如果你有孩子,这可以是一个非常有趣和有意义的活动。使用Android智能手机,谷歌地图或使用Chromecast在您的电视都可以观看圣诞老人的全球旅程。虽然用户可以在笔记本电脑,智能手机或平板电脑上跟踪圣诞老人... 查看全文
· ios开发之C语言第4天发布时间:2017-01-09
自增和自减运算自增运算符++自增表达式1>.前自增表达式.intnum=1;++num;2>.后自增表达式intnum=1;num++;3>.无论是前自增表达式还是后自增表达式,都是将自身的值加1.自增表达式是一个表达式,既然是一个表达式,那么这个表达式就一定有一个结果.那么我们就可以用一个变量将这个结果存储起来.1>.后自增表达式的结果的计算方式:先将自身的值取出来作为后自增表达式的结果.然后再将自身的值+1.2>.前自增表达式的结果的计算方式:先将自身的值+1... 查看全文
在手机上运行BT真的没问题吗?BitTorrent可能是这个世界上最受欢迎的BT下载客户端,不过最近几年BitTorrent公司一直在试图拓展BT下载以外的业务。毕竟BitTorrent是一个免费软件,而BT下载又一直被各国政府和版权机构封杀,所以日子并不好过。BitTorrentLive是该公司在今年5月份发布的一款在线视频服务,它使用了P2P的技术来帮助直播者降低服务器和带宽的开销。和BT下载一样,每个观看直播的观众都将成为一个直播的中转节点,在从服务器接收最新直播画面的同时... 查看全文
· iOS开源项目周报1222发布时间:2016-12-24
由OpenDigg出品的iOS开源项目周报第二期来啦。我们的iOS开源周报集合了OpenDigg一周来新收录的优质的iOS开发方面的开源项目,方便iOS开发人员便捷的找到自己需要的项目工具等。ios-ossKickstarter的开源iOSappTinyConsole一个小巧的日志控制器Jelly几行代码定制ViewController动画Import从代码中任何地方添加imports的Xcode扩展brickkit... 查看全文
前言断点续传概述断点续传就是从文件赏赐中断的地方重新开始下载或者上传数据,而不是从头文件开始。当下载大文件的时候,如果没有实现断点续传功能,那么每次出现异常或者用户主动的暂停,都会从头下载,这样很浪费时间有木有。所以呢,项目中实现大文件下载的时候,断点续传功能是必不可少了。当然咯,断点续传有一种特殊的情况,就是我们的应用呗用户kill掉或者应用crash,要实现应用重启之后的断点续传,这种情况就是我们将要解决的问题。断点续传的原理要实现断点续传,服务器必须是要支持的。目前最常见的两种方式... 查看全文
最近,苹果电脑业务遭遇了媒体质疑。有消息称苹果将会放弃台式机业务,这遭到了首席执行官库克的否认。另外彭博社报道披露,苹果已经取消macOS专职开发团队。据悉,目前苹果macOS和iOS两大操作系统的开发,由原先的iOS团队来负责。这意味着苹果笔记本后续功能的开发,可能会遭到削弱。外媒指出,对于苹果来说,销售和利润前景最好的电子设备,将获得最大限度的关注和资源,而目前智能手机正是最受重视的业务。比如平板电脑iPad,在去年的iOS9更新中,苹果曾经为商用大平板推出分屏显示功能... 查看全文
一、需求iOS9中新增AppTransportSecurity(简称ATS)特性,主要使到原来请求的时候用到的HTTP,都转向TLS1.2协议进行传输。这也意味着所有的HTTP协议都强制使用了HTTPS协议进行传输。因此移动api需要配置为https并且要支持tls1.2二、项目情况服务器端:公司的服务器的采用的操作系统是centos,开发语言php,web容器采用的nginx。客户端:iosandroid客户端和服务的通信采用http和jsonapp内的部分功能通过webbiew加载h5完成... 查看全文
· iOS app内存分析套路发布时间:2016-12-24
iOSapp内存分析套路Xcode下查看app内存使用情况有2中方法:Navigator导航栏中的Debugnavigator中的MemoryInstruments一.Debugnavigator中的Memory此方法是查看内存最简单直接有效的方法,真机调试时,通过Debugnavigator中Memory查看app内存,入口如图根据这个值查看app内存占用,这个内存是当前app占用的总内存,是堆栈内存、虚拟内存(OpenGL占用的显存算在虚拟内存中里面)的总和... 查看全文
开源iOS项目分类索引大全GitHub上大概600个开源iOS项目的分类和介绍,对于你挑选和使用开源项目应该有帮助系统基础库Category/Utilsstoolkit一套Category类型的库,附带很多自定义控件功能不错~BlocksKit将Block风格带入UIKit和Founcationcocoa... 查看全文
说起tableView的自动计算行高,真的是不想再提了,写了不知道几百遍了。可就是这麽一个小玩意儿,把我给难的不行不行的,眼看都要没头发了。1、设置tableView的预估行高和行高为自动计算1//设置预估行高2self.tableView.estimatedRowHeight=200;3//设置行高自动计算4self.tableView.rowHeight=UITableViewAutomaticDimension;2... 查看全文